Milena
Membros-
Total de itens
191 -
Registro em
-
Última visita
Tudo que Milena postou
-
Gostaria de deletar registros de várias tabelas... mas não estou conseguindo....
-
Quem puder me ajudar.... deve ser fácil pra vocês.... e preciso disso urgentíssimo....
-
Alterei o que você disse.... ma meu update só funciona quando coloco um valor ... no lugar da variável campo: strsql ="UPDATE Produtos SET NomeProduto='"&nome&"' where CodigoProduto='9'" Apesar de eu estar utilizando um response.write pra verificar o valor do campo ... e este está vindo corretamento..... é um campo texto então estou usando assim : where CodigoProduto='"&campo&"'" Mas não funciona ....
-
Página Alterar , vai exibir os dados que o usuário quer alterar em inputs:
-
Sim, mas , olha como ele está sendo enviado no sumbit , Campo é a variável que está guardando o valor... <input name="cdproduto" type="text" id="cdproduto" value=" <%response.write Campo>"> mas ele chega na minha página de update ... com o valor correto, tenho certeza que tenho o registro. strsql ="UPDATE produtos SET CodigoProduto='"&cdproduto&"', CodigoDepartamento='"&cddepartamento&"',NomeProduto='"&nome&"', DescricaoProduto='"&descricao&"', preço='"&preço&"',PrecoVenda='"&precovenda&"',Quantidade='"&quantidade&"' where CodigoProduto='"&campo&"'" objRS.open strsql Mas vou ver o que faço aqui... obrigada pela ajuda de vc ... []´s
-
Desculpe-me por estar perguntanto tanto ... mas é que sou muito leiga em aps Agora com o Where ... ele não atualiza nenhum regitro.... olhem o código :
-
Acredito que o problema seja com essa variável intpagina.... IF intpagina > 1 then <a href="exe_buscar_produtos.asp?pagina=<%=intpagina-1%>">Anterior</a> <% END IF Ajudem-me ...plz.
-
VALEU !! RESOLVIDO !!! Mas agora quem não parece mais é o botão de anterior.... Set RS = Server.CreateObject("adodb.recordset") RS.PageSize = 5 'quantidade de registros por página. Você pode alterar sem conforme precise. 'Vamos fazer a busca na tabela contatos SQL ="SELECT * FROM produtos where CodigoProduto='13' " RS.Open SQL,Conn,3,3 Dim Campo, teste Campo=Request.Form("campo") teste=Request.Form("busca") select case teste case "escolha1" RS.Close response.write "entrei no case" SQL = "SELECT * FROM produtos WHERE CodigoProduto='"&campo&"' " RS.Open SQL,Conn,3,3 case "escolha2" RS.Close SQL= " SELECT * FROM produtos WHERE NomeProduto='"&campo&"' " RS.Open SQL,Conn,3,3 case "escolha3" RS.Close SQL= " SELECT * FROM produtos WHERE Quantidade='"&campo&"' " RS.Open SQL,Conn,3,3 case "escolha4" RS.Close SQL= " SELECT * FROM Produtos WHERE preço='"&campo&"' " RS.Open SQL,Conn,3,3 end select 'Vamos agora verificar exceções do tipo “fim de arquivo” (EOF), se a página atual é menor 'que zero, se é maior que o número total de páginas, etc. IF RS.BOF then 'response.write "Arquivo não encontrado" response.Redirect("error_buscar_produtos.asp") Response.End 'paramos o programa ELSE 'Definindo em qual pagina o visitante está IF Request.QueryString("pagina")="" then intpagina=1 ELSE IF cint(Request.QueryString("pagina"))<1 then intpagina=1 ELSE IF cint(Request.QueryString("pagina"))> RS.PageCount then intpagina=RS.PageCount ELSE intpagina=Request.QueryString("pagina") END IF END IF END IF END IF 'Fim das verificações de exceções 'Usamos a propriedade AbsolutePage para dizer ao RS que página ele esta RS.AbsolutePage=intpagina ' Inicia o contador que vai controlar os registros mostrados intrec=0 'Enquanto o contador for menor que a quantidade de registros mostrados ou ' não for o final do arquivo While intrec < RS.PageSize and not RS.EOF %> <% RS.MoveNext ' Acrescenta +1 ao contador intrec=intrec+1 'Se for EOF (fim de arquivo), imprimir branco na tela IF RS.EOF then response.write " " END IF Wend 'fim do loop 'Vamos verificar se não é a página 1, para podermos colocar o link “anterior”. IF intpagina > 1 then %> <!--AQUI -AQUI AQUI -AQUI AQUI -AQUI AQUI -AQUI --> :huh: <a href="exe_buscar_produtos.asp?pagina=<%=intpagina-1%>">Anterior</a> <% END IF 'Se não estivermos no último registro contado, então é mostrado o link p/ a próxima página IF strcomp(intpagina,RS.PageCount) <> 0 then %> <a href="exe_buscar_produtos.asp?pagina=<%=intpagina + 1%>">Próxima</a> <% END IF %> Muito obrigada pela atenção de vocês !
-
vou tentar
-
Olá !! Tentei da forma que vocês me disseram.... acontece que ele está abrindo a pasta onde está meu arquivo.html, não está abrindo a página no Browser..... estou colocando abaixo o código da função: <script language="javascript" type="text/javascript"> var windowpic = null ; function openWide( file_path, title_text, width, height ) { var scrW=screen.width; var scrH=screen.height; if (scrH < "600") { W=630; H=425; } else if (scrH < "768") { W=788; H=544; } else { W=1012; H=710; } var scbar = "no" ; var tbar = "no" ; var bars = "menubar=no,toolbar=no" ; if( tbar == "yes" ) bars = "menubar=no,toolbar=no" ; var strwindow = "toolbar=no,width=" + W + ",height=" + H + ",directories=no,status=no,scrollbars="+ scbar+"," + bars + ",resizable=no" + ",top=" + 0 +",left=" + 0; if (navigator.appName == "Microsoft Internet Explorer") { strwindow = "toolbar=no,width=" + W + ",height=" + H + ",directories=no,status=no,scrollbars="+ scbar+"," + bars + ",resizable=yes" + ",top=" + 0 +",left=" + 0; } file_path = 'opcao/index_port.htm'; file_path += '?loclist=' + "&cmdebug=" + ''; window.location=C:\Documents and Settings\Programador\Desktop\Site_2005\opcao\index_port.htm"; //document.location.href = "C:\Documents and Settings\Programador\Desktop\Site_2005\opcao\index_port.htm"; } </script>
-
Tirei o RS.CLOSE do CASE 1 como o Cyberalexxx falou.... mas não adiantou.... []´s Milena
-
Estou aprendendo asp agora...e estou tendo sérias dificuldades em criar uma paginação... imagino que seja bem simples.... até pelo fato de que a minha está funcionado ... até que eu estraguei... Está dando erro quando clico em PRÓXIMO PARA VIZUALIZAR O RESTANTE DOS REGISTROS.... Operação não permitida quando o objeto está FECHADO. line 46 Segue abaixo o código: ____________________________________________________________________ Set RS = Server.CreateObject("adodb.recordset") RS.PageSize = 5 Dim Campo, teste Campo=Request.Form("campo") teste=Request.Form("busca") select case teste case "escolha1" RS.Close response.write "entrei no case" SQL = "SELECT * FROM produtos WHERE CodigoProduto='"&campo&"' " RS.Open SQL,Conn,3,3 case "escolha2" SQL= " SELECT * FROM produtos WHERE NomeProduto='"&campo&"' " RS.Open SQL,Conn,3,3 case "escolha3" SQL= " SELECT * FROM produtos WHERE Quantidade='"&campo&"' " RS.Open SQL,Conn,3,3 case "escolha4" SQL= " SELECT * FROM produtos WHERE preço='"&campo&"' " RS.Open SQL,Conn,3,3 end select IF RS.EOF then -> ESSA É A LINHA QUE ESTÁ DANDO ERRO !!!!! Response.Write "nenhum registro encontrado" Response.End 'paramos o programa ELSE 'Definindo em qual pagina o visitante está IF Request.QueryString("pagina")="" then intpagina=1 ELSE IF cint(Request.QueryString("pagina"))<1 then intpagina=1 ELSE IF cint(Request.QueryString("pagina"))> RS.PageCount then intpagina=RS.PageCount ELSE intpagina=Request.QueryString("pagina") END IF END IF END IF END IF RS.AbsolutePage=intpagina intrec=0 While intrec < RS.PageSize and not RS.EOF %>
-
Não. Na verdade, eu já sabia dessas propriedades do windows.open. O que acontece eu que tenho um link, e quando é clicado chama uma função em java para identificar o browser que está sendo usado e a resolução, e ajustará então o tamanho da página que será aberta..... e para abrir esta página estou usando o window.open.... mas a página abre em uma nova janela.... e não é isso que quero... preciso abri-la na mesma página.... mas mantendo a função java de redimensionamento. Valeu por estarem ajudando
-
Alguém pode me ajudar?
-
Olá pessoas !! Gostaria de saber quais são os parâmetros aceitos na função WINDOWS.OPEN gostaria que quando abrisse o link, abrisse na mesma janela... seria como o target :_Self tem como? espero que esteja dando pra entender ... Obrigada Milena